Definitions from Wiktionary (galop)

noun:  A lively French country dance of the nineteenth century, a forerunner of the polka, combining a glissade with a chassé on alternate feet, usually in a fast 2/4 time.
noun:  The music for a dance of this kind.
verb:  To dance the galop.
